A6 Speed Camera Torched


Article by: rob brady
Date: 22 Nov 2013

pocketgpsworld.com
There has been an arson attack on a speed camera on the central reservation of the A6 Loughborough Road, Loughborough in Leicestershire.

A local fire crew extinguished the flames, but the camera has been put temporarily out of action by the attack.

The static speed camera was installed last year following the tragic deaths of two people along that stetch of road.

It has been reported that 2,462 speeding offences have been registered at the site so far this year.

The local Safety Camera Partnership, commented: "We don't have a major local problem with camera arson, however, when it does occur it presents a danger to not only other road users but also our employees who have to deal with the consequences, including inspecting and retrieving fire damaged equipment."

The camera will be out of action until January.
